Transaction ef4b23d72f48c8431d2ad36b63fbf2fe80616b1c2879416718fcceb77c25257e

1 Input
2 Outputs
  • ef4b23d72f48c8431d2ad36b63fbf2fe80616b1c2879416718fcceb77c25257e:0
  • value  145284751
    address  3EJRMjgKnaPQqSMPDPEzjtG5vNBn2Ubxek
  • ef4b23d72f48c8431d2ad36b63fbf2fe80616b1c2879416718fcceb77c25257e:1
  • value  14220219442
    address  1887iK7g8CafNJRVzuvmJuSNjQitPaaMh7